About this tag
The mobile growth tag on WindowsForum.com covers the rapid expansion of AI assistant usage on mobile devices, as highlighted by Comscore data showing a 107% year-over-year increase in mobile visitation to AI assistant destinations in December 2025. Discussions also explore how Microsoft's in-house AI models, such as MAI-Voice-1 and MAI-1-preview, are being developed to support cross-platform experiences, including mobile. The tag reflects the intersection of mobile device adoption, AI technology, and platform strategy, with a focus on how mobile growth is reshaping consumer interaction with AI tools and influencing enterprise and developer considerations.
